This typeface is a serif italic with a distinctly calligraphic construction: strokes are tapered with modest contrast and a consistent rightward slant. Serifs are small and bracketed, with sharp, clean terminals and occasional teardrop-like endings that reinforce a pen-drawn feel. Proportions are traditional and slightly compact, with flowing curves in letters like C, G, and S, and a lively rhythm created by varied entry/exit strokes across the lowercase.
It performs well for extended reading in editorial and book contexts, especially where an italic with character is desirable. It is also a strong choice for pull quotes, introductions, captions, and formal correspondence or invitations that want a traditional, polished typographic color.
The overall tone is classic and literary, projecting refinement without feeling rigid. Its italic voice reads expressive and cultured, suited to work that benefits from a traditional, bookish elegance rather than overt display styling.
The design appears intended as a conventional text serif italic with an emphasis on readability and classical proportion, while preserving the nuanced liveliness of pen-influenced forms. It aims to provide an elegant italic voice that can carry narrative and emphasis comfortably in real-world text settings.
Uppercase forms remain restrained and upright in structure while still adopting the italic stress, giving headings a dignified presence. Numerals and lowercase show noticeable stroke modulation and angled joins, which adds movement and helps the face feel at home in continuous text.
